This bread is not only beautiful in shape, but also contains cranberries, which my son likes. The skin is thin and slightly crispy, and the inside is soft. The sweet and sour cranberries make it delicious and satisfying. The refrigerated and fermented bread is particularly soft, and even office workers can make it easily. They can knead the dough overnight and take it out the next day to make it. As soon as it comes out of the oven, it is praised by family members. It’s worth a try if you like it!

  1. Knead 240 grams of high-gluten flour, 20 grams of egg whites, 65 grams of light cream, 80 grams of milk, and 2 grams of yeast until the dough is smooth.

    Leaf Bread step 1
  2. Refrigerate and ferment for 24 hours until about 2.5 times in size.

    Leaf Bread step 2
  3. Take out the fermented ground seed dough, tear it into small pieces, mix with 15g of milk powder, 20g of egg white, 30g of fine sugar, 2g of salt, 1g of yeast, 12g of butter, and knead until the dough is smooth.

    Leaf Bread step 3
  4. While kneading the dough, it’s time to make the cranberry soufflé filling. Soften 75 grams of butter and add 25 grams of powdered sugar and beat until puffy and white

    Leaf Bread step 4
  5. Add 20 grams of egg liquid in three batches, stirring evenly each time.

    Leaf Bread step 5
  6. Add 55 grams of milk powder and stir evenly.

    Leaf Bread step 6
  7. Add 50 grams of cranberries.

    Leaf Bread step 7
  8. Stir evenly, cover with plastic wrap and place in the refrigerator.

    Leaf Bread step 8
  9. After kneading until smooth, add 12 grams of butter softened at room temperature and continue the kneading process for 20 minutes.

    Leaf Bread step 9
  10. When there are ten minutes left, add 35 grams of cranberries and knead until the dough can form a large, tough film. Leave to ferment in a warm place until 2.5 times in size.

    Leaf Bread step 10
  11. After taking out the dough and deflating, divide it evenly into 5 small doughs, cover with plastic wrap and let rest for 15 minutes.

    Leaf Bread step 11
  12. Take a piece of dough, deflate it and flatten it with the palm of your hand.

    Leaf Bread step 12
  13. Fill with cranberry soufflé filling.

    Leaf Bread step 13
  14. Pinch to seal and shape into a triangle. Place seal side down in a gold baking pan.

    Leaf Bread step 14
  15. Place in a warm place to ferment until about 2.5 times in size. After 2.5 times in size, sift flour on the surface.

    Leaf Bread step 15
  16. Use a knife to make cuts, and bake in a preheated oven at 180 degrees for about 15-18 minutes, until you see the bread color.
